Summary
In life, nothing is ever constant but change. And in this episode, Louise Hay shows that these changes and transitions are not linear in nature. In the same way, the pathway to success is not a straight line.
According to Louise, the model of success is not linear. You will enjoy gains and suffer losses or experience joys and frustrations. But all these are necessary parts of growth and development. And for Louise, these challenges are regular occurrences as one undergoes changes in life, especially a transition from fear into a place of love, peace, and prosperity.
As Louise explains the meandering process of Learning and progress, we realize that behind every pain comes with it a gem of wisdom. Finally, Louise believes that every challenge is not meant to beat you down but build you up.
